B-BBEE Calculator for Excel Integration
Calculate your Broad-Based Black Economic Empowerment score and generate Excel-ready reports
Your B-BBEE Calculation Results
Comprehensive Guide to B-BBEE Calculator Excel Integration
The Broad-Based Black Economic Empowerment (B-BBEE) framework is a critical component of South Africa’s economic transformation policy. For businesses operating in South Africa, understanding and accurately calculating B-BBEE scores is not just a compliance requirement but a strategic business advantage. This comprehensive guide will walk you through everything you need to know about B-BBEE calculators and their integration with Excel for efficient reporting and analysis.
Understanding the B-BBEE Scorecard
The B-BBEE scorecard evaluates companies across five key pillars:
- Ownership (25 points): Measures effective ownership by black people, including voting rights and economic interest
- Management Control (19 points): Assesses black representation at board and executive management levels
- Skills Development (20 points): Evaluates investments in developing skills of black employees
- Enterprise and Supplier Development (40 points): Examines procurement from empowered suppliers and support for black-owned businesses
- Socio-Economic Development (5 points): Measures contributions to socio-economic development initiatives
For large enterprises, companies must comply with all three priority elements (Ownership, Skills Development, and Enterprise and Supplier Development) to avoid being discounted by one B-BBEE level.
Important: The B-BBEE Commission provides official guidelines that should be consulted for accurate compliance. Visit the B-BBEE Commission website for the latest updates.
Why Use an Excel-Integrated B-BBEE Calculator?
Integrating B-BBEE calculations with Excel offers several advantages:
- Automation: Reduce manual calculation errors with automated formulas
- Version Control: Maintain historical records of scorecard improvements
- Scenario Planning: Model different empowerment strategies to optimize your score
- Reporting: Generate professional reports for stakeholders and verification agencies
- Audit Trail: Create transparent records for verification purposes
Step-by-Step Guide to Building Your B-BBEE Excel Calculator
Creating an effective B-BBEE calculator in Excel requires understanding both the B-BBEE codes and Excel’s advanced functions. Here’s how to build one:
1. Structure Your Workbook
Create these essential sheets:
- Input Sheet: For entering all your company data
- Calculations Sheet: For all formulas and intermediate calculations
- Results Sheet: For displaying final scores and levels
- Dashboard: For visual representation of your B-BBEE status
2. Set Up Your Input Parameters
In your Input Sheet, create sections for:
- Company information (size, sector, etc.)
- Ownership details (black ownership %, women ownership %, etc.)
- Management control data (board composition, executive management)
- Skills development metrics (training spend, learners, etc.)
- Procurement data (supplier spend by B-BBEE level)
- Socio-economic development contributions
3. Implement the Calculation Logic
Use these key Excel functions:
IFstatements for conditional scoringVLOOKUPorXLOOKUPfor reference tablesSUMIFSfor weighted calculationsMIN/MAXfor capping scoresROUNDfor proper score formatting
Example formula for ownership calculation:
=MIN(25, (BlackOwnership%*2.5) + (BlackWomenOwnership%*1.5) + (BlackNewEntrants%*0.5))
4. Create Visualizations
Use Excel charts to visualize:
- Scorecard performance by pillar
- Year-over-year improvements
- Gap analysis against targets
- Supplier spend by B-BBEE level
5. Implement Data Validation
Add these validation rules:
- Percentage fields limited to 0-100
- Dropdown lists for standard options
- Conditional formatting for out-of-range values
- Error checking for required fields
Advanced Excel Techniques for B-BBEE Calculations
For more sophisticated calculators, consider these advanced techniques:
1. Dynamic Arrays (Excel 365)
Use functions like FILTER, SORT, and UNIQUE to create dynamic reports that automatically update when input data changes.
2. Power Query for Data Transformation
Import and clean supplier data from various sources, then transform it into the format needed for B-BBEE calculations.
3. PivotTables for Analysis
Create interactive reports that allow users to drill down into specific aspects of your B-BBEE performance.
4. Macros for Automation
Record or write VBA macros to:
- Automate data entry from other systems
- Generate standardized reports
- Perform complex calculations not possible with standard formulas
- Create custom functions for specific B-BBEE calculations
Common Challenges and Solutions
| Challenge | Solution |
|---|---|
| Complex weighting formulas | Break calculations into smaller, intermediate steps with clear labeling |
| Changing B-BBEE codes | Create a separate “Codes” sheet with all parameters that can be easily updated |
| Data entry errors | Implement comprehensive data validation and error checking |
| Supplier data management | Use Power Query to clean and standardize supplier information |
| Version control | Save each version with date stamps and maintain a change log |
Integrating with Verification Agencies
When preparing for verification:
- Documentation: Ensure all claims can be substantiated with proper documentation
- Sampling: Understand that verification agencies may sample your data
- Materiality: Focus on material items that significantly impact your score
- Consistency: Maintain consistent methodologies year-over-year
- Transparency: Be prepared to explain all calculations and assumptions
The South African Institute of Chartered Accountants (SAICA) provides guidance on B-BBEE verification processes that can help prepare your Excel calculator for audit.
B-BBEE Scorecard Comparison by Company Size
| Element | Micro Enterprise | Qualifying Small Enterprise | Generic Enterprise |
|---|---|---|---|
| Ownership | 100% of 40 points | 25 points | 25 points |
| Management Control | Exempt | 19 points | 19 points |
| Skills Development | Exempt | 25 points (5 bonus) | 20 points (5 bonus) |
| Enterprise & Supplier Development | Exempt | 40 points | 40 points |
| Socio-Economic Development | Exempt | 5 points | 5 points |
| Total Points | 100 (simplified) | 100 | 100 |
| Priority Elements | N/A | Ownership + 1 other | All 3 elements |
Best Practices for Maintaining Your B-BBEE Excel Calculator
- Regular Updates: Update your calculator whenever B-BBEE codes change (typically every few years)
- Version Control: Maintain a clear version history with change logs
- Documentation: Document all formulas and assumptions for future reference
- Backup: Keep secure backups of your calculator file
- Training: Train multiple team members on how to use and update the calculator
- Validation: Periodically validate calculations against manual computations
- Security: Protect sensitive sheets and cells from unauthorized changes
Alternative Solutions to Excel Calculators
While Excel is powerful, consider these alternatives for more advanced needs:
- Specialized B-BBEE Software: Dedicated solutions like B-BBEE Pro or Empowerdex
- ERP Integration: Some enterprise systems have B-BBEE modules
- Cloud Solutions: Web-based calculators with collaboration features
- Custom Development: Bespoke solutions tailored to your specific needs
For academic research on B-BBEE implementation, the University of the Witwatersrand has published several studies on the economic impacts of B-BBEE policies.
Future Trends in B-BBEE Calculation
Several trends are shaping the future of B-BBEE calculations:
- AI-Assisted Verification: Machine learning to detect anomalies in B-BBEE claims
- Blockchain for Transparency: Immutable records of B-BBEE transactions
- Real-Time Reporting: Continuous monitoring instead of annual assessments
- Integrated ESG Reporting: Combining B-BBEE with broader ESG metrics
- Mobile Solutions: Apps for capturing B-BBEE data in the field
As these technologies evolve, Excel will likely remain a fundamental tool for B-BBEE calculations, but may be supplemented with more specialized solutions for specific aspects of compliance and reporting.